InZOI, the upcoming life simulation game, is generating significant buzz within the gaming community by introducing seasons and dynamic weather systems right from its base version. This feature distinguishes it from its competitor, The Sims, where players must purchase additional content to experience such elements.
The game's dedication to realism is evident through its high-quality graphics, detailed character models, and expansive open-world setting. Creative Director Hengjun Kim recently confirmed that InZOI will include all four seasons in its initial release, adding depth to the gaming experience. Players, or Zois, will need to adapt to these seasonal changes by choosing appropriate clothing to avoid health issues ranging from minor colds to potentially fatal conditions. This adaptation mechanic will be crucial in various weather scenarios, from scorching heat to freezing cold.
InZOI is slated for an early access launch on March 28, 2025, as detailed on its Steam page, which will include voiceovers and subtitles. The developers at Krafton are committed to supporting the game for the next 20 years, with a vision that they believe will take at least a decade to fully realize.
